Top 5 AI Apps for Students in 2026

As students navigate their academic journeys, leveraging technology has become essential. In 2026, several AI applications stand out, designed to enhance productivity, streamline learning, and foster organization. Here, we highlight the top five AI apps that every student should consider adopting.

1. Grammarly - This AI-powered writing assistant is indispensable for crafting essays, reports, and emails. It checks for grammatical errors, style issues, and offers suggestions for clarity and conciseness. With its ability to learn a user’s writing style, Grammarly provides personalized feedback, making it a valuable tool for improving writing skills.

2. Quizlet - Quizlet uses AI to help students study efficiently. The app allows users to create digital flashcards and study sets while leveraging algorithms to personalize study sessions based on strengths and weaknesses. Additionally, Quizlet Live enables collaborative learning, fostering an interactive approach to group study sessions.

3. Notion - As a versatile organization tool, Notion combines note-taking, task management, and project collaboration. Its AI functionalities allow for smart tagging, auto-sorting notes, and even generating to-do lists based on keywords. Notion’s flexibility makes it valuable for students juggling multiple subjects and extracurricular activities.

4. Socratic - Designed to assist with homework, Socratic employs AI to provide explanations and resources for various subjects. Students can take pictures of their homework questions, and the app delivers step-by-step solutions and relevant educational material. This app empowers students to grasp complex concepts, making learning more accessible.

5. Microsoft Teams - With a focus on collaboration and communication, Microsoft Teams integrates AI to streamline team workflows. It supports video calls, chat functionalities, and file sharing, essential for group projects and remote learning. The platform also incorporates tools for scheduling and task assignment, promoting efficient teamwork.

In-Depth Reviews of Each AI App

As the educational landscape embraces technological advancements, several AI applications have emerged as invaluable tools for students. The following reviews explore some of the most impactful AI apps available in 2026, analyzing their features, benefits, and limitations.

First on our list is Grammarly, an AI-powered writing assistant touted for its exceptional grammar checking and style suggestions. Grammarly not only identifies grammatical errors but also enhances overall writing by offering style improvements and tone adjustments. Its premium version includes advanced features like plagiarism detection and vocabulary enhancement, proving beneficial for both academic and professional writing. User feedback frequently highlights its user-friendly interface, although some users find the subscription pricing a bit steep based on their needs.

Next is Microsoft Math Solver, an intuitive app that assists students in solving mathematical problems. By utilizing AI algorithms, the app offers step-by-step solutions, making it easier for students to understand complex concepts. The free version provides numerous functionalities, yet some advanced features are locked behind a premium subscription. Student users often praise it for its detailed explanations, although there are occasional challenges related to the app's accuracy with certain types of equations.

Another noteworthy application is Quizlet, an AI-driven study tool that allows students to create, share, and study flashcards. Its AI features personalize learning paths based on user performance, fostering a tailored educational experience. Quizlet's collaborative features enhance peer learning, enabling groups to study together effectively. However, the mixed reviews often pertain to its reliance on user-generated content, potentially impacting the quality of information available.

Lastly, Notion stands out as a versatile organizational tool that leverages AI for smarter note-taking and project management. Its flexibility allows for customized layouts, making it an appealing choice for individuals who prefer a personalized approach to their studies. Users generally appreciate its wide range of functionalities, though the learning curve can be daunting for new users.

Integrating AI Apps into Your Study Routine

As students increasingly turn to technology to facilitate their learning processes, effectively integrating AI applications into daily study routines has become essential. To begin, students should first ensure they have downloaded the most useful AI apps that align with their learning objectives. This might include applications for organization, note-taking, or even tutoring. Once these apps are installed, it is crucial to explore their features to understand how they can best serve your educational needs.

Creating a balanced study schedule that incorporates both digital tools and traditional methods is important. For example, students may set specific times for focused study sessions using AI-assisted tools, such as language translation or study reminder apps, while also allocating time for reading textbooks or handwritten notes to reinforce learning. This blended approach allows students to benefit from the modern attributes of AI without entirely relying on technology.

Moreover, to maximize the potential of these AI applications, students should utilize their features strategically. This can include setting specific goals within the apps, such as tracking progress in studying or being reminded of upcoming deadlines and exams. Additionally, students can benefit from using AI-based tools for practice exams or quizzes, providing immediate feedback that can enhance learning outcomes. Participating in online study groups through these apps can also provide varying perspectives and aid in knowledge retention.

Lastly, regular reflections on the study process can help students adjust their routines and improve efficiency. Gathering insights on which AI applications prove most helpful can lead to tailoring one's study habits effectively. 1. Are AI apps safe to use regarding data privacy?

Data privacy is a significant concern for students utilizing AI applications. Most reputable AI apps implement robust encryption methods and adhere to data protection regulations, which are essential in safeguarding personal information. Nonetheless, it is crucial for students to read the privacy policies of these apps to understand how their data is collected, used, and stored. Additionally, opting for applications that are transparent about their data handling practices is recommended to ensure a safer experience.

2. Are AI tools cost-effective for students?

Cost-effectiveness is another important consideration. While some AI applications charge subscription fees, others offer free or tiered pricing models. Students should weigh the benefits of using these tools against their financial investment. Free trials can provide an excellent opportunity for students to evaluate the functionalities of an AI app before committing to a paid version, ensuring that they make a financially sound decision.

3. What are the potential downsides of relying on AI apps?

While AI apps can greatly enhance productivity and learning, an over-reliance on these tools may lead to diminished critical thinking and problem-solving skills. It is vital for students to balance their use of AI applications with traditional learning methods. Engaging in active learning and applying knowledge independently will help students avoid becoming overly dependent on technology, ensuring they remain well-rounded in their academic pursuits.
